About Samsung's mid-range smartphone Galaxy The A52 5G has been on the air since November, and now it looks like we should be seeing its launch soon. It has obtained the Chinese CCC safety certification.

Also known as 3C, the certification revealed that the successor to the hugely successful model Galaxy A51 it will support 15W fast charging, or that it will be manufactured in a Samsung factory in Vietnam.

The smartphone has also already appeared in the popular Geekbench 5 benchmark, in which it scored 298 points in the single-core test and 1001 points in the multi-core test. The benchmark also revealed that it will be powered by a Snapdragon 750G chipset, complemented by 6GB of RAM, and that the software will be built on Androidin 11

According to unofficial reports and renders leaked so far, he should Galaxy A52 5G will also get a Super AMOLED Infinity-O display with a diagonal of 6,5 inches, a back made of highly polished glass-like plastic called Glasstic, a quad rear camera with a resolution of 64, 12 and twice 5 MPx, a fingerprint reader integrated into the display and 3,5 mm jack.

The phone is expected to be unveiled in the next few weeks. The state would have around 499 dollars (converted to less than 11 thousand crowns).
